"In the Red at Bridal Veil Falls" , 6x18, pastel



I loved taking my Plein Air class to sites around Cleveland this fall.  We painted a lake in the thick fog, on the edge of a gorgeous gorge , and this scene at the base of a loooong stairway down to this beautiful waterfall that's part of the Metro Park system. It was late fall and a crisp day as we teetered on the stairway landings to catch our views.   This was my demo, mostly done on location and then tweaked with a stroke or two back at my studio. Painted on Ampersand pastel board with a wide range of soft pastel brands.

California Nocturne No.2, 11x14, pastel



Here is one of my California Nocturne series, based on videos my kids who live in and around San Francisco send me. I freeze frame the video and paint the composition just as I like it. It's sort of the next best thing to being there!  They hike up in the hills near Palo Alto after work, and catch some beautiful, serene sunsets in the dry grasses that are so typical of the California landscape.
